Troubleshooting a Phone That Won’t Connect to WiFi After DNS Change

Changed the DNS on your network or device and suddenly your smartphone won’t join WiFi? This is a common snag. A DNS change can block how your phone talks to the internet, even when the connection shows as strong. This guide walks you through clear, device specific steps to get back online fast. You’ll learn how to diagnose whether the issue lies with the phone, the network, or the DNS settings themselves, and you’ll get practical fixes you can apply today.

Quick checks you should do first

  • Test another device on the same network. If a laptop or another smartphone connects without trouble, the problem is likely with the phone or its settings.
  • Power cycle everything. Turn off the router, wait 20 seconds, then turn it back on. Do the same with your phone.
  • Forget and reconnect to the network. Remove the saved network on your phone, then reconnect with the correct password.
  • Verify the date and time on the phone. An incorrect clock can cause security checks to fail and prevent connections.
  • Disable any VPN or security app temporarily. Some tools block DNS traffic or interfere with network handoffs.

If these quick checks don’t resolve the issue, you’re ready to determine where the problem lies

Determine where the problem lies: device vs network

  • If other devices connect normally but your phone does not, the issue is likely on the phone side. It could be a misconfigured DNS, a network setting, or a software glitch.
  • If your phone cannot connect on any WiFi network, the problem could be hardware or OS related on the phone. In rare cases the wireless antenna or radio module may be at fault.
  • If the problem appears only on a specific network, focus on that router or the DNS settings you changed there.

DNS change context and its effects

DNS acts like a phone book for the internet. It translates the names you type into the numbers devices use to reach servers. When you switch DNS settings, several outcomes are possible:

  • The new DNS server is slow or unreachable, causing timeouts when apps try to reach services.
  • The DNS configuration on the router and the phone is out of sync, so the phone cannot complete the network handshake properly.
  • IPv6 vs IPv4 issues cause compatibility problems for some networks and devices.
  • A privacy or security feature, such as DNS over TLS, may block certain types of traffic if not set up correctly.

With this in mind, the quickest path to a fix is to rule out DNS as the cause and then reintroduce a known good DNS.

Step by step troubleshooting guide

Start with the simplest fixes and work toward more involved changes. The goal is to restore a stable path for DNS lookups while keeping your network secure.

Revert DNS on the device to automatic

  • Android: Open Settings, navigate to Network and Internet, then WiFi. Tap the gear icon next to your network, open Advanced, and look for IP settings. If it shows Static, switch to DHCP (or Automatic). Save and reconnect.
  • iPhone: Open Settings, then Wi-Fi, tap the active network, and select Configure DNS. Choose Automatic. Reconnect to the network.

If the problem disappears after this step, the issue was tied to a manual DNS entry on the device. You can try a different approach later without forcing a full revert.

Set a known good DNS

  • On Android or iPhone, after restoring automatic DNS, you can still test a known good DNS to see if the issue was the DNS server itself.
  • Common safe picks are Google DNS 8.8.8.8 and 8.8.4.4, or Cloudflare 1.1.1.1 and 1.0.0.1. Enter them in the manual DNS fields for your network if you prefer explicit control.
  • Reconnect to the network and test access to a few sites. If pages load more quickly and consistently, the DNS server you chose is performing better for you.

Clear network settings on the phone

  • Android: In Settings, find System, then Reset options. Choose Reset Wi-Fi, mobile, and Bluetooth settings. Confirm. This wipes saved networks and related preferences but leaves your data intact.
  • iPhone: Settings, General, Reset, Reset Network Settings. Confirm. The phone will reboot and you’ll need to rejoin networks and reenter passwords.

Resetting network settings often resolves stubborn DNS mismatches by reestablishing clean network profiles.

Update the operating system

  • Check for OS updates on both platforms. A pending patch can fix DNS handling bugs or network compatibility issues that show up after a DNS change.
  • Install any available updates, then restart the phone and try the WiFi connection again.

Check router DNS settings if you control the network

  • If you recently changed the router’s DNS, revert to the ISP’s automatic DNS or use a DNS you know to be reliable.
  • Ensure the router’s DHCP server is active. If it’s disabled or misconfigured, devices may fail to obtain an IP address even with a good DNS.
  • Verify there are no MAC address filters blocking the phone. Some routers block devices based on their hardware address until whitelisting is complete.
  • If the router supports DNS over TLS or DoH, try turning that feature off temporarily to test connectivity.

Private DNS and DNS over TLS

  • Some devices use a private DNS setting that routes DNS lookups through a specific server. If you enabled private DNS on Android, switch it off or set it to automatic for testing.
  • iPhones can be affected by network-level DNS features. If you have a managed profile or a security app, review any restrictions that might interfere with DNS.

Specific steps for Android and iPhone users

Android users

  • Start with a clean slate on WiFi: forget networks and re-add them.
  • Check IP settings per network. If you switch from DHCP to a static IP, ensure the DNS fields are filled correctly; otherwise, revert to DHCP.
  • Use the Private DNS setting for testing. Turn it off to see if standard DNS resolves the issue.
  • If your phone still cannot connect, try connecting to a different WiFi network, such as a hotspot from another phone. If that works, the problem is highly likely tied to your home network.

iPhone users

  • Reconfigure DNS as Automatic or Manual for a known DNS. If you pick Manual, use a single well-known DNS like 8.8.8.8 and 8.8.4.4.
  • Reset network settings if the problem persists. This step is powerful; you’ll need to rejoin networks afterward.
  • Test on a new network to confirm whether the issue is network specific or device related.
  • If all WiFi networks fail, consider a hardware repair or testing another iPhone to isolate the fault.

Router level checks and ongoing maintenance

  • Review firmware updates for the router. An outdated firmware can cause DNS handling issues after a change.
  • If possible, reset the router to factory defaults and reconfigure from scratch. Start with automatic DNS, then test one network at a time.
  • Keep a simple log of DNS settings you test. This helps avoid repeating the same steps and makes troubleshooting faster in the future.

Testing and validation

  • After each change, test basic web access on the smartphone. Try loading a few different sites to confirm DNS responses are correct.
  • If your device can connect to a guest network or a hotspot, that’s a good indicator the problem is specific to the primary network configuration.
  • If you still cannot connect after these steps, consider professional support. A technician can check hardware faults and more advanced configuration issues.

When to seek help and what to bring

  • Note your phone model, current OS version, and any recent DNS or network changes.
  • Bring details about the router model, firmware version, and any DNS settings you tried.
  • If you used a VPN, DoH, or private DNS, share those specifics. They can be pivotal to finding a solution.
  • If possible, test with a second phone or device to confirm whether the problem is devicespecific.

Prevention and best practices

  • Document DNS configurations. If you adjust DNS again, keep a simple record of what works.
  • Use stable DNS services for home networks. Public DNS can work well, but avoid frequent changes that cause compatibility issues.
  • Avoid mixing DNS methods on devices and routers. If the router uses automatic DNS, don’t override it with manual entries on every connected device without a clear need.
  • Regularly update devices and routers. Software updates fix known issues and improve reliability.
  • Maintain a clean backup of network profiles. If you need to reset, you can rebuild settings quickly.
